Selecting Data to Migrate

When selecting the data to migrate, to maintain the links between your data, such as projects and WIP, all data must be migrated at the same time. Any future migration will not restore the links in CCH Axcess.

To select the data to migrate, do the following:

  1. Choose from the following options to select the data to migrate:
    • Practice. Migrate all Practice data, including time and expense transactions, WIP, and AR.
    • Common data. Migrate only the information that is common for client and staff data, and the minimum amount of data that can be migrated. This option is checked and disabled by default.

    Note: Selecting any option that does not include Practice and Projects strips all references to Project IDs from your WIP transactions and prevents the running of reports to see the budget and actual amount of WIP per project. Any projects or Practice transactional data migrated at a later time are no longer linked by project.

  2. Select the amount of Practice history to migrate by selecting one of the following options:
    • Migrate all records including historic details. All transactions are migrated. Depending on the number of years contained in the history database, this selection could considerably increase the migration processing time. Selecting this option allows the running of reports on historical data to compare years of data. Once this option has been selected and at least one record migrated, it cannot be changed.
    • Migrate all records with details of open items. This option migrates any WIP transaction or AR record that contains a balance. Details of zero balances and closed or completed records are not migrated. Once you have selected the amount of data to migrate, and at least one record migrated, you cannot change this option.
